Post by: fajita on February 05, 2018, 16:43:21 PM
I printed off 20 pages. P6-20 were templates.

P1 fabric requirements and assembly tips
P2 colouring sheet
P3 an outline print with no directions
P4 assembly instructions
P5 assembly instructions
P6-20 templates

It wasn't too difficult, more tedious than anything. Probably done best over a longer time frame and shorter sessions. I just sat with the dog after his chemo and ploughed through it. Having a rest now before making it into something.
